Optimalization of Leishmania antigen formulations for the diagnosis of canine leishmaniasis.
Danková, Barbora ; Němečková, Ivana (advisor) ; Vokřál, Ivan (referee)
Charles University in Prague Faculty of Pharmacy in Hradec Králové Department of Biological and Medical Sciences Student: Barbora Danková Supervisor of diploma thesis: RNDr. Ivana Němečková, Ph.D. Specialized Supervisor: Prof. Anabela Cordeiro da Silva Title of diploma thesis: Optimalization of Leishmania antigen formulations for the diagnosis of canine leishmaniasis Leishmaniasis is a vector-borne disease caused by a protozoan parasite of the genus Leishmania and is prevalent in 98 countries worldwide. Reliable and accurate tests are necessary for laboratory diagnosis of Leishmania infection because of the wide spectrum of clinical characteristics and symptoms and high rate of asymptomatic infections that may occure. Serological diagnosis of canine leishmaniasis (CanL), especially enzyme-linked immunosorbent assay (ELISA), proved to be usefull tool. Data obtained from ELISA assay for the detection of antibodies against selected recombinant A, B, C, D, E and F proteins were evaluated in infected canine sera from Portugal and Brazil. This work presents the best formulation of recombinant proteins for serological diagnosis. We found that antigen C showed high level of sensitivity and specificity in recognition of positive and asymptomatic sera infected with CanL. Key words: canine leishmaniasis,...
Alteration of transport proteins expression during obstructive cholestasis in rats II
Skořepová, Zuzana ; Doleželová, Eva (advisor) ; Němečková, Ivana (referee)
5 Abstract Zuzana Skořepová Alteration of transport proteins expression during obstructive cholestasis in rats II Diploma thesis Charles University in Prague, Faculty of Pharmacy in Hradec Králové Pharmacy Background: The aim of the diploma thesis was the verification of cholestatic liver impairment induced by bile duct obstruction lasting for 28 days in rats, by analysis of mRNA and protein expression of liver efflux transport proteins (Bsep, Bcrp, Mrp2, Mdr1, Mdr2, Mrp3, Mrp4). Methods: Wistar rats (n = 6, in each group; weighing 280 to 320 g) were divided into two groups: control rats were sham-operated (Sham) and BDO group (bile duct obstruction lasting for 28 days). mRNA and protein expression changes of the transporters were perfomed by qRT-PCR and Western blot. Results: As compared to Sham group, BDO group showed increase of mRNA expression of Mdr2 transporter to 303%, Mdr1b to 340% and Mrp3 to 9900%. Mrp2 mRNA expression was decreased to 42%. Obstructive cholestasis led to significant increase of protein levels - Bcrp to 160%, Mdr1 to 1010%, Mrp3 to 940% and Mrp4 to 140%. Mrp2, Bsep and Mdr2 protein levels were increased to 31%, 59% and 82%, respectively. Conclusion: Obstructive cholestasis led to decrease of canalicular liver transporters expression and increase of basolateral liver transporters...
Screening for systemic amyloidoses in endoscopic biopsy samples.
Květoň, Martin ; Nachtigal, Petr (advisor) ; Němečková, Ivana (referee)
Charles University in Prague Faculty of Pharmacy in Hradec Králové Department of Biological and Medical Sciences Diploma thesis Candidate: Bc. Martin Květoň Branch of study: Specialist in Laboratory Methods Supervisor: prof. PharmDr. Petr Nachtigal, Ph.D. Title: Screening for systemic amyloidoses in endoscopic biopsy samples BACKGROUND Systemic amyloidoses constitute a complex and heterogeneous group of serious diseases that result from protein misfolding and whose common feature is the deposition of pathological protein substances (amyloid) in the extracellular space of tissues. Diagnostics of amyloidoses is based on histopathological examination of tissue samples and direct demonstration of the presence of amyloid deposits. The overall purpose of this diploma thesis was to create, apply and subsequently evaluate a screening program focused on systemic amyloidoses. METHODS In the first part of the experimental study, available staining techniques used for the detection of amyloid deposits in the tissue were compared. The second part of the experimental study consisted of performing screening examinations on endoscopic biopsy samples of the gastrointestinal tract. RESULTS Based on the results of comparison, a method employing the Sirius red F3B dye was chosen as a suitable screening technique....
Immunochemical Detection of PECAM-1 Expression in Hypertensive Rats
Hocková, Erika ; Nachtigal, Petr (advisor) ; Němečková, Ivana (referee)
6 ABSTRACT Charles University in Prague, Faculty of Pharmacy in Hradec Kralove Department of Pharmacology and Toxicology Candidate: Mgr. Erika Hocková Consultant: Doc. PharmDr. Petr Nachtigal, Ph.D. Title of Thesis: Immunochemical detection of PECAM-1 expression in hypertensive rats Hypertension - abnormally high blood pressure - is a lifestyle disease, which belongs to the most frequent cardiovascular diseases. Hypertension seems to be a non-infectious epidemy with 25 to 30 % prevalence in adult population and presents a serious health problem. PECAM-1 is an adhesive signal molecule expressed on hematopoetic and endothelial cells, creating the main component of the vascular tissue. Regarding its structure, it belongs to the immunoglobuline super-family of adhesive molecules. Sunitinib is a biological treatment molecule of the group of tyrosine-kinase inhibitors used for treatment of generalised renal carcinoma and gastrointestinal stromal tumours. Farmacologically, sunitinib is antineoplastic substance - protein-kinase inhibitor. The main adverse effect of sunitinib is hypertension. The aim of this rigorous thesis was to define and to describe the expression of endothelial PECAM-1 in the aorta of spontaneously hypertensive rats (SHR) and their normotensive control group (Wistar - Kyoto rats - WKY)...
Influence of fixation time and fixation type on immunohistochemical analysis in the detection of stem cells in endometrial tissue.
Macháčová, Dominika ; Nachtigal, Petr (advisor) ; Němečková, Ivana (referee)
Charles University, Faculty of Pharmacy in Hradec Králové Department of Biological and Medical Sciences Title of Diploma Thesis: Influence of fixation time and type of fixative solution on immunohistochemical analysis in the detection of stem cells in endometrial tissue Author: Bc. Dominika Macháčová Supervisor of Diploma Thesis: prof. PharmDr. Petr Nachtigal, Ph.D. Backgroud: The aim of this diploma thesis was to investigate the effect of the type of fixative solution and the length of fixation on immunohistochemistry. Materials and methods: A total of five porcine and five bovine endometria obtained from hysterectomy specimens were included in this study. Immunohistochemical staining with progesterone receptors and SOX2 in endometrium fixed in five fixative solutions (Formol, Antigenfix, Greenfix, Bouin, Methacarn) were performed after 1,5; 8,5; 15,5; 29,5; 64,5 and 189,5 days of fixation. An automated immunostainer Ventana Benchmark Ultra was used for all immunohistochemical analysis. Results: Expression of progesterone receptors was demonstrated in 92-87 % of glandular cells after 1,5-64,5 days and in 59 % of cells after 189,5 days of formalin fixation. The intensity of staining was strong, but after 189,5 days it was evaluated as being weak. In Antigenfix-fixed tissues, strong progesterone...
Immunohistochemical analysis of endoglin and cell adhesion molecules expression in NASH experimental model
Vašinová, Martina ; Nachtigal, Petr (advisor) ; Němečková, Ivana (referee)
Nonalcoholic steatohepatitis (NASH) is an aggressive form of nonalcoholic fatty liver disease, which is characterized by liver inflammation and fibrosis. It was shown that membrane endoglin (ENG) participates on fibrosis and plasma concentrations of soluble endoglin were increased in patients with type II diabetes mellitus, and hypercholesterolemia. The purpose of this study was to analyze the expression of ENG, biomarker of fibrosis (αSMA/alpha smooth muscle actin), and biomarkers of inflammation (ICAM-1, VCAM-1) in liver in mice. Wild type mice were divided into two groups (n=8 in each group), control group was fed with chow diet and experimental/NASH group was fed with high fat diet with fructose and glucose in drinking water (NASH diet) for 6 months. Expression of selected proteins was evaluated by means of immunohistochemistry (ImmPRESSTM and VECTASTAIN® ELITE® ABC kit) on formalin-fixed, paraffin-embedded liver sections. The results of this study showed that the expression of VCAM-1 and ICAM-1 was detected in liver sinusoids and it was higher in NASH group. Similarly, we showed higher expression of ENG in NASH group in comparison with control. Moreover, αSMA was found not only in blood vessels, but also in hepatic stellate cells in NASH group compared to control suggesting fibrotic process...
Morphological characteristic of alterations in the striatum induced by neurodegenerative process in the brain
Němečková, Ivana
("Morphological characteristics of alterations in the striatum induced by neurodegenerative process in the brain") Huntington's disease (HD) is an inherited neurodegenerative disorder. Although the cause of HD, i.e. the production of the mutant form of unstable protein huntingtin (mhtt) which contains 40 and more CAG repeats is known, the effective therapy is not yet available. Therefore, the use of animal models is crucial for the study of the pathogenesis of this fatal disorder. To date, there is no suitable experimental model simulating the neurodegenerative process (NDP) developing in the striatum of the human HD brain. Most of rodent models of HD fall into two broad categories - the neurotoxic lesions and genetically engineered models. The primary aim of our study was a comprehensive morphological description of the development of NDP of HD phenotype in the striatum of the rat brain. We compared the progression of NDP in the lesion induced by intrastriatal injection of quinolinic acid (QA) and in rats transgenic for HD. The groups of male rats surviving for 3, 6-7, 14 days, 1, 3, 6, 9 and 12 months after the QA lesion were compared with 2-, 6-, 12-, 18-, 22-24-month-old tgHD rats and age-matched control (intact) counterparts in both groups. The primary morphological feature of the NDP of HD...
Copper reducin properties of a series of xanthe-3-ones
Kopková, Nikola ; Mladěnka, Přemysl (advisor) ; Němečková, Ivana (referee)
Charles University Faculty of Pharmacy in Hradec Králové Department of Pharmacology & Toxicology Candidate: Nikola Kopková, MSc Consultant: Assoc. Prof. Přemysl Mladěnka, PharmD., Ph.D. Title of diploma thesis: Copper reducing properties of a series of xanthen-3-ones Key words: copper, reduction, xanthene-3-one, homeostasis Copper is present as a trace element in all tissues and is essential in cellular respiration, in the biosynthesis of neurotransmitters, for the scavening of reactive oxygen species, and is also a cofactor for various enzymes. Disruption of homeostasis can lead to liver and CNS damage, and tumor formation. Typical examples of an imbalance in copper homeostasis represents Wilson and Menkes disease. Xanthene derivatives are biologically active compounds with a possible broad therapeutic spectrum. Some of these derivatives have antitumor, antipyretic, immunomodulatory, antioxidant and other positive biological activities. The aim of this work was to determine whether 2,6,7-trihydroxyxanthen-3-one derivatives have the ability to reduce cupric ions and possibly to detect the effect of various substituents on this ability. As a methodology, a spectrophotometric method based on bathocuproindisulfonic acid as an indicator was used. Ten compounds were tested at different pH values. All...
Effect of glucose treatment on endoglin and biomarkers of endothelial dysfunction in endothelial cells
Adamcová, Adriana ; Nachtigal, Petr (advisor) ; Němečková, Ivana (referee)
Charles University, Faculty of Pharmacy in Hradec Králové Department of Biological and Medical Sciences Title of Diploma Thesis: Effect of glucose treatment on endoglin and biomarkers of endothelial dysfunction in endothelial cells Author: Adriana Adamcová Supervisor of Diploma Thesis: prof. PharmDr. Petr Nachtigal, Ph.D. Background: The aim of this thesis was to evaluate the expression of endoglin and biomarkers of endothelial dysfunction (eNOS, VCAM-1) in aortic endothelial cells exposed to oscillating glucose. Methods: Human aortic endothelial cells (HAECs) were treated with alternating normal (5 mM) and high (25mM) glucose for 7 days. The control group, was treated with a constant level of normal glucose. Gene expression of endoglin, eNOS, VCAM-1, HIF1α, KLF6, RELA and LXR was measured by quantitative real-time PCR. Flow cytometry was used to detect endoglin and VCAM-1 protein levels. Results: Treatment with high levels of glucose resulted in significantly increased expression of endoglin, eNOS, VCAM-1, HIF1α, RELA and LXR by means of PCR. The flow cytometry method showed a significant difference in protein levels in both endoglin and VCAM-1. Conclusions: The results of this diploma thesis showed that oscillating glucose increases the expression of endoglin and other biomarkers of endothelial...
